E-Waste Collection, Paper Shredding Event Slated for May 7 in Culver City

 


Homeboy Recycling will provide Culver City with several convenient electronics recycling services, including hosting quarterly drive-through collection events for the public.

HomeBoy will continue the quarterly e-waste and paper shredding events on the first Saturday of each quarter from 9 a.m. to 1 p.m. These events will be held at Syd Kronenthal Park, located at 3459 McManus, on the following dates: May 7 and August 6.

Chris Zwicke, CEO of Homeboy Electronics Recycling, stresses the importance of community partnerships. “We look at the ‘problem’ of e-waste as an opportunity to create quality jobs for people who really need them. Not only do we make sure to keep electronics out of landfills, where toxic materials can pollute our soil, water, and air, but we also refurbish computers and other electronics, increasing the supply of affordable IT equipment in our community. This partnership between Homeboy and Culver City makes a truly positive local impact.”

Homeboy Electronics Recycling is an R2 certified social enterprise offering nationwide service for the proper disposal and management of IT assets. Each year, the company refurbishes thousands of computers and divert millions of pounds of electronics away from the landfill while creating jobs for people facing systemic barriers to employment.

Homeboy Industries, for over 30 years, is the largest gang rehabilitation and re-entry program in the world.
